Raigarh The City Of Heritage
Raigarh is an important city in the state of Chhattisgarh and is known for its rich cultural heritage and industrial development. It is often called the Cultural Capital of Chhattisgarh because of its deep roots in classical music and Kathak dance. The city beautifully blends tradition with growing modern infrastructure. Raigarh is also an important center for education, trade, and industry in eastern Chhattisgarh.
State: Chhattisgarh
Country: India
Location: Eastern Chhattisgarh
Famous For: Cultural heritage, Kathak dance, and steel industries
Major Rivers: Kelo River
Language: Hindi (official), Chhattisgarhi
Climate: Tropical climate with hot summers, monsoon rains, and mild winters
Population: A mix of tribal communities and urban population
Major Attractions: Ram Jharna, Kelo Dam, Gomarda Wildlife Sanctuary
Nickname: Cultural Capital of Chhattisgarh
